jQuery Responsive Select Menu gives you a simple way to make your navigation menus responsive for mobile devices like phones and tablets (iPhone, Android, Kindle, etc). The plugin lets you specify a width at which to turn your normal menus into responsive, drop-down select menus – a proven method for solid, responsive navigation.
You also get specify some other handy settings including:
- CSS class/ID selectors to specify exactly which menus to affect
- The width at which to switch from normal to responsive navigation menus
- The character/spacer to add to sub-items in your drop-down select menu
- A “dummy” first term to add to the top of your drop-down navigation (e.g. ⇒ Navigation)
- Whether to show the current page, or the top-level “dummy” item, as the default
